Top-10 Best Airlines of the Year



06/19/2015 - 17:34



Skytrax, having gathered information about the flights, released the rating of the best airlines in 2015 according to the customers. The survey was attended by 18.9 million travelers from 105 countries. It study involved more than 245 airlines that were evaluated by 41 parameter - from the process of boarding the plane to seat comfort and level of service on the board.

Below are the top 10 airlines, according to customers.

10. Qantas
Ranking last year: 11

Despite the fact that last year the company has experienced a number of unpleasant moments, related to financial issues, the level of Qantas’ service remains at a rather high level. The airline has received high marks for customer service.

9. EVA Air
Ranking last year: 12

Taiwanese airline EVA Air was founded in 1989 and is a subsidiary of the global transport giant Evergreen Group. Over the past two years, the airline has experienced rapid growth and now has a large fleet of Airbus and Boeing at its disposal.

8.Garuda Indonesia
Ranking last year: 7

Garuda Indonesia has experienced major changes in recent years after the airline was considered unsafe to fly in the EU between 2007 and 2009. Indonesian airline has taken serious measures to improve the quality of the fleet and services to regain the trust and favor of customers, as well as service supervision.

7. All Nippon Airways (ANA)
Ranking last year: 6

All Nippon Airways - the largest international carrier in Japan, as well as the airline with one of the world's largest fleets of Boeing 787 Dreamliner. Airline ANA received high marks Skytrax of travelers, hit almost all the criteria, especially in the area of cleanliness on board, the level of service and security.

6. Etihad Airways
Ranking last year: 9

Airline Etihad is the national airline of the United Arab Emirates, its planes are flying in 96 directions. Clients marks extras -noise canceling headphones in the cabin, and much more.

5. Emirates
Ranking last year: 4

Over the past 10 years, Dubai-based airline Emirates has become one of the best airlines in the world in the segment of long journeys. The company operates solely on the basis of Dubai International Airport, at the time, it has a huge fleet of aircraft Airbus A380 and Boeing 777.

The aircraft carrier provides aboard the ability to view video or listen to music and watch TV channels. In fact, the airline is the best in entertainment content provided on board.

4. Turkish Airlines

Ranking last year: 5

Turkish Airlines is the national airline of Turkey, with head office in the popular tourist center Istanbul.

The airline has broken the record for the available destinations - it flies to more than 100 countries and over 200 cities worldwide.

The airline is growing rapidly, it is a member of Star Alliance. In addition, the airline received an award as the best airline in Europe for the past five consecutive years.

3. Cathay Pacific Airways
Ranking last year: 1

Hong Kong airline Cathay Pacific this year fell in the rankings compared to last year. Nevertheless, it was the best transpacific airline. This airline is one of the best in Asia, providing services at the highest level.

2. Singapore Airlines
Ranking last year: 3

Singapore Airlines aims to provide the flight services to its customers at the highest level, serve them with respect and care. The airline operates from the International Airport Changi - one of the best airports in the world, which has been recognized as Best Airport by Skytrax customers for the third year in a row.

1. Qatar Airways
Ranking last year: 2

For the third time the airline Qatar tops the list: it became the leader in 2011 and 2012. Customers airline noted the high level of comfort seats and entertainment content provided on board.

The airline serves more than 125 destinations around the world. In addition, it extends the card service on 50 new destinations, including direct flights to Los Angeles, Miami and Dallas.
